I've released a new version of KEGS v1.32, an Apple IIgs emulator for Mac, Windows, and Linux at: http://kegs.sourceforge.net/
Changes in KEGS v1.32 since v1.31 (11/22/23)
- Fix (dloc,x) in emulation mode to wrap as described at
https://github.com/gilyon/snes-tests/tree/main/cputest
- Improve virtual hard drive in slot 7 to use a small driver at $C700 which
uses WDM $C7,$00 to call back to KEGS for handling commands.
- Improve SCC8530 emulation to add support for RTxC as clock for higher speeds.
- Fix a GS/OS visual anomaly with the mouse cursor sometimes disappearing
when moving upwards, due to Scanline interrupts not being taken
properly.
- Support qkumba's code to run from $C050 by having get_remaing_opcodes()
track time properly, and to have reads to $C050-$C057 call float_bus()
before doing the softswitch action.

I've had one strange thing crop up in KEGS 1.32 under Windows 10 that I cannot duplicate in 1.31 and 1.30 --
To duplicate it:
1. Launch KEGS and boot into the GS/OS Finder;
2. Hit the 'F4' key to enter the configuration menu;
3. Hit 'escape' key to exit the configuration menu;
4. Press 'return'.
When you go back to the emulated GS' Finder window, KEGS throws up a
Code RED.
I can confirm the same behavior running KEGS 1.32 under MacOS.
Other than the RED condition, everything seems to run fine, though.
